    Last known information

    On November 27th, 2022, we last heard from Ken via "Whatsapp"; apparently, he left his host family's residence and boarded the train headed for Valence, France. Ken's phone pinged on Wednesday, November 30th, 2022; his phone has had zero activity since this date.


    We learned through communications that Ken had gone to classes on November 28th. However, communication has not happened from his phone or any social media since Sunday, November 27th. According to authorities, Ken has not made contact with any of the friends he has made in France since attending classes on November 28th. Those that saw him in class on November 28th said Ken was normal and happy.

    Missing college student Kenny DeLand Jr. is alive, his father says

    Kenny DeLand Jr., the American student who went missing more than two weeks ago in Grenoble, France, is alive, his father Ken DeLand Sr. told CNN on Friday.

    DeLand Jr. is in Spain, French Prosecutor Eric Vaillant told CNN, adding only that the young man had spoken Friday with his parents.

    DeLand Jr.’s father had been in the middle of a call with CNN when he suddenly hung up. He later messaged CNN to report “good news” – and he’d just spoken with his son.

    “He is alive – that’s all I can say,” he told CNN.

    Deland Sr. did not elaborate on what his son told him and did not explain where his son has been for the past two weeks.
